New Daily Driver Arrived. MCS

Our new Mini Cooper S finally arrived after a two month order. Couldn't justify the 15 mpg SS as a daily and needed something we can abuse mileage wise. The Mini is awesome to drive and has some potential as its a turbo engine now from Peugoet. I bought the lowering springs and wheels for it. I haven't had a chance to lower it yet, but the wheels look great. I promised myself I wouldn't mod it, but the madness has already started as I weighed the wheels when I swapped for the other ones. 3 pounds per corner shed already LOL... Here are some pics I thought I'd share. Just wanted to post it up in case someone was thinking about one for a daily driver. Gas mileage is ridiculous at about 34 highway/28 city and it feels and drives just like a 100k Mercedes.
